The Power Shift: Why Solar-Plus-Storage is the New Standard
For years, solar panels alone were the gold standard. You'd generate power during the day, export the excess to the grid, and draw power back at night. It was a good start. But the energy phenomenon we're witnessing today reveals the limitations of this model. Grid instability, rising electricity costs, and a growing desire for sustainability are driving a fundamental change.
Consider the data: The U.S. Energy Information Administration (EIA) notes that interruptions in U.S. customer power supply have remained steady or increased in recent years, often due to extreme weather. Meanwhile, electricity prices for households in the European Union saw an increase of over 30% between 2021 and 2022. This volatility isn't just a line item on a bill; it's a risk to business continuity and household comfort.
This is where the modern interpretation of "solarium energy" shines. By pairing solar panels with a sophisticated battery storage system, you create a personal microgrid. The solar array generates clean energy. The battery stores the surplus—energy that would have been sold to the grid for pennies—and makes it available precisely when you need it most: during peak rate periods, grid outages, or at night. The system becomes an active asset, managing energy flow based on your usage patterns, tariff schedules, and even weather forecasts.
The Limitations of Solar-Only Systems
- Grid Dependence: You're still vulnerable to blackouts. When the grid goes down, standard solar systems shut off for safety.
- Financial Leakage: You export excess energy at low rates, only to buy it back later at much higher retail prices.
- Unoptimized Consumption: You use solar power only when the sun shines, missing the chance to maximize self-consumption.
Case Study: A Real-World Look at "Solarium Energy" in Action
Let's move from theory to practice with a concrete example from California, USA. A medium-sized commercial vineyard faced a critical challenge: frequent Public Safety Power Shutoffs (PSPS) to prevent wildfires threatened to disrupt their refrigeration units and irrigation systems, risking an entire season's harvest.
Their solution was a true "solarium energy" system. They installed a 250 kW solar canopy over their parking lot, coupled with a 500 kWh battery energy storage system (BESS). The results, tracked over one year, were compelling:
| Metric | Before System | After System Installation |
|---|---|---|
| Grid Energy Consumption During Peak Hours | 100% | 15% |
| Impact of Grid Outages | Full operational shutdown | Zero disruption; critical loads powered for 72+ hours |
| Annual Electricity Costs | $72,000 | $18,000 (75% reduction) |
| Carbon Footprint | ~180 metric tons CO2e | ~25 metric tons CO2e |
This case exemplifies the transformative power of integrated storage. The battery wasn't just a backup; it became a financial tool, strategically discharging during expensive peak periods (a process called peak shaving) and ensuring resilience. Choosing the Right System: What to Look For in a "Solarium Energy" Provider
Not all systems labeled "solarium energy for sale" are created equal. The market is full of options, and the key differentiators lie in the intelligence of the storage system and the quality of integration. Here’s what discerning buyers should prioritize:
- Seamless DC-Coupling: Advanced systems integrate the battery at the DC level of the solar panels. This is more efficient than AC-coupling, as it reduces energy conversion losses, meaning more of your precious solar energy ends up stored and used.
- AI-Powered Energy Management: The brain of the system. Look for software that learns your consumption, predicts solar production, and automatically optimizes storage and grid interaction to maximize savings and resilience.
- Scalable & Modular Design: Your energy needs may grow. A quality system allows you to add more battery capacity or solar panels in the future without replacing the entire infrastructure.
- Proven Safety & Warranty: Insist on certified battery technology (like LiFePO4 chemistry, known for its stability) and a robust, long-term warranty that covers both performance and capacity retention.
